The City Cormrlssion of the City of Clearwater Florida met in regular session
the eveilimg of May 1, 1944 at 8:00 P. l~i. in the City Hall, with the following
members present:
George R. Seavy - Mayor Con~issioner
Dan L. stoutamire - ~
Jessie G. ::lm1 th "
Sumner R. Lowe "
Absent - Herbert. Grice
The meeting was duly culled to order by Mayor Seavy and the minutes of the
previous meeting were read 5nd approved.
Mr. Al Rogero and three youn~ people representing the Jouth Council appeared
before the 'co &rd rela ti ve to the C1 ty makinb use of the Peace Memorial Gymn-
asium for youne; people. The Ci ty Commission instructed 11r. hoe;ero to to.et
a more definite commitment from the Board of Deacons of the Presby:ter.Lan
Church relative to the 0ity's use of the building also to ascertain for sure
whether the younb people would prefer the Gymnasium over their present
meetinb place in the i~udi torium.

City ~ana~er Llendrix presented to the bo~rd an applioati~n of the Recreutlon
Departmen t. of the (.;i ty for addi tional funds under the Lanham .hct, in the
amount of ~10,764.00 less local contributions of' 'ili2l00.00 from the Community
Che st. The Ci ty l.:ommissi.:m approved the ap pli ca tiol! v;i thout formb.l vote.
Ci ty Ivianager Eendrix read a resolution passed by th e .Ac1erican Legj:on of
Clearwater requesting the City Commission to move the flat, pole and
Memorial at the foot of Cleveland Street to the Puzrk V:ay in front of the
said Auditorium. It was moved by Mr. .Lowe seconded by l/:r. 3toutamtre and
oarried that the opinion as expressed in tte resolution be approved.
Set out elsewhere in these minutes is tte letter from the American Le/:.,ion
and a oopy of the above memtioned resolution.

Seoond: That it is hereby determined that a tax: of five mills
upmn all property wi thin the City, no t exempt f'rolll taxation by law,
shall be necessary to raise the said sums appropriated for operating
purposes, end the said rate of milla&e is hereby assessed on all real
and personQl property upon said tax assessment roll not exempted by
la~ from taxation.
Third.: That it is hereby determined that the follovvine, rates
of millage shall be necessary to raise the necessary sums t.'or debt ser-
vice on the vity's outstandiDb bonded indebtedness, and said rates of
millage are 11ereby assessed abainst th e prope.rty in c1 ud ed in said tax
assessment roll, as rollows:
